Originally Posted by Scott@RealTraps Seriously . . . as others have said, if you can blow through it with *very* little or no resistance, you're good. The main thing that matters here is not to impede the gas flow into the glass/mineral fiber. It isn't so incredibly critical that you are likely to screw something up as long as you have good air flow through the fabric. Simple. |
